The drop rates are actually better than Dynamis it's just that each zone has different drops for the level 15 armors. Most people assume that every zone's 15 armor is the same as Bhauflau Remnants. Bhauflau is by and far the easiest to get level 15 armor on simply because it drops off normal mobs. Silver Seas is a little more difficult because the 15 armor shares drops with the 35 on NMs (although the 15 is 100%). I think Arropogo and Zhayolm both have drops off gears on the 4th floors. I could be wrong about that one. All known boss kills have dropped 2 and exactly 2 level 25 armors which is terrific when you consider the drop rates off other bosses and NMs in the game. The 35 armor is the only real problem. Not all of the NMs are known at this time and so it is hard to guage thier drop rates. So far as I see it the only difficult part about getting Salvage gear is the time it takes to aquire all three parts and the extra material costs to upgrade to the finished item.
